首頁 > 資料庫 > mysql教程 > 利用MySQL的AVG函數計算資料表中數字列的平均值方法

利用MySQL的AVG函數計算資料表中數字列的平均值方法

WBOY
發布: 2023-07-24 21:52:54
原創
1760 人瀏覽過

利用MySQL的AVG函數計算資料表中數字列的平均值方法

簡介:
MySQL是一種開源的關係型資料庫管理系統,擁有豐富的內建函數來處理和運算數據。其中,AVG函數是用來計算數字列的平均值的函數。本文將介紹如何使用AVG函數來計算MySQL資料表中數字列的平均值,並提供相關的程式碼範例。

一、建立範例資料表
首先,我們需要建立一個範例資料表來進行示範。假設我們有一個名為「students」的資料表,其中包含了每個學生的學號(student_id)和成績(score)等資訊。可以使用以下程式碼來建立該資料表:

CREATE TABLE students (
   student_id INT PRIMARY KEY,
   score INT
);
登入後複製

二、插入範例資料
接下來,我們需要在「students」表中插入一些範例資料。可以使用以下程式碼來插入一些學生的成績資訊:

INSERT INTO students (student_id, score) VALUES
   (1, 85),
   (2, 92),
   (3, 76),
   (4, 88),
   (5, 91);
登入後複製

三、使用AVG函數計算平均值
現在,我們已經創建了範例資料並插入了一些學生的成績資訊。接下來,我們可以使用AVG函數來計算這些成績的平均值。以下是使用AVG函數的程式碼範例:

SELECT AVG(score) as average_score FROM students;
登入後複製

執行以上程式碼將會傳回一個名為「average_score」的列,其中包含了學生成績的平均值。可以透過以下程式碼將結果作為表格輸出:

SELECT FORMAT(AVG(score),2) as average_score FROM students;
登入後複製

四、計算結果說明
以上程式碼將會傳回一個名為「average_score」的列,其中包含了學生成績的平均值,並保留兩位小數。如果我們執行該指令,將會得到以下結果:

+--------------+
| average_score|
+--------------+
|     86.40    |
+--------------+
登入後複製

結論:
使用MySQL的AVG函數可以很方便地計算資料表中數字列的平均值。透過以上的程式碼範例,我們可以看到AVG函數的簡單易用性,並且可以靈活地處理不同的資料表結構。這對於進行數據統計和分析是非常有用的。

總而言之,利用MySQL的AVG函數計算資料表中數字列的平均值方法非常簡單,只需使用一行程式碼即可完成。希望本文的介紹能幫助讀者更能理解並應用AVG函數,提升資料處理與計算的效率。

以上是利用MySQL的AVG函數計算資料表中數字列的平均值方法的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板